The Quality Assurance Lead, will be responsible for coordinating & conducting comprehensive testing of IT systems, including scenario and regression testing. The incumbent will collaborate with cross-functional teams, analyze requirements, develop test plans, execute test cases, and ensure the quality and reliability of our IT systems. The incumbent’s role will be instrumental in identifying defects, ensuring system functionality, and maintaining a high level of software quality. The role will involve managing both business and technology aspects of workstreams within large transformation initiatives throughout the project lifecycle utilizing Agile and waterfall methodologies. Essential Job Functions:

  • Test Planning and Strategy: Collaborate with stakeholders to understand system requirements, features, and functionalities. Develop test plans, test strategies, and test scenarios based on project objectives, system architecture, and business requirements.
  • Test Case Development: Design, create, and document test cases and test scripts based on functional and non-functional requirements. Ensure that test cases cover all aspects of the system under test, including positive and negative scenarios, error handling, and edge cases. 
  • Test Execution: Execute test cases and test scripts to validate system functionality, data integrity, and performance. Perform functional, regression, and integration testing to identify defects and ensure system stability and reliability. 
  • Defect Management: Identify, track, and report defects using defect tracking tools. Collaborate with developers, business analysts, and stakeholders to investigate and resolve defects. Conduct root cause analysis to identify underlying issues and recommend appropriate solutions. 
  • Test Environment Setup: Collaborate with infrastructure and operations teams to set up and configure test environments. Ensure that test environments are representative of the production environment to accurately simulate real-world scenarios. 
  • Test Data Management: Create and manage test data sets, ensuring they cover various test scenarios and edge cases. Develop and maintain test data repositories for efficient test case execution and reusability.
  • Test Automation: Identify opportunities for test automation and work with the automation team to develop and maintain automated test scripts. Execute and monitor automated tests to increase testing efficiency and coverage. 
  • Test Reporting and Documentation: Generate test reports, including defect reports, test execution status, and test coverage. Document test procedures, test results, and other relevant documentation to facilitate knowledge sharing and future reference. 
  • Practice/Process Development: Contribute to Quality Assurance practice development via innovation, process development, knowledge sharing, and bringing new ideas/ solutions to fruition though change management and delivery.
  • Project Management: Successful coordination/ facilitation of all aspects of an initiative (or workstream within an initiative), to bring about the desired results. 
  • Relationship Management: Manage relationships and expectations of workstream/project. Influence, collaborate, and partner with several diverse stakeholder functions through effective communication and well-tuned interpersonal skills.
